On , OSHA opened a planned safety inspection of UNITED STATES COLD STORAGE in 4302 SOUTH 30TH STREET, OMAHA, NE 68107 (NAICS 493120). OSHA activity number 347121220.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.147(f)(3)(ii): Group lockout or tagout devices were not used in accordance with procedures required by 29 CFR 1910.147(c)(4): Employees performing maintenance activities at United States Cold Storage located at 4302 South 30th Street, Omaha, Nebraska were exposed to struck-by hazards in that multiple employees performed servicing and maintenance under energy control device(s) applied by one individual. Instances included but were not limited to: i. On or about November 17, 2023, approximately two employees repairing and/or servicing overhead dock door #5 while using one lock. ii. On or about January 8, 2024, approximately two employees repairing and/or servicing overhead dock door #3 while using one lock. iii. On or about January 16, 2024, approximately two employees repairing and/or servicing overhead dock door #11 while using one lock.

29 CFR 1910.151(c): Where the eyes or body of any person may be exposed to injurious corrosive materials, suitable facilities for quick drenching or flushing of the eyes and body shall be provided within the work area for immediate emergency use. Employees engaged in battery maintenance activities at United States Cold Storage located at 4302 South 30th Street Omaha, Nebraska were exposed to chemical contact and burn hazards in that the employer did not ensure the pathway between the battery maintenance area (charging and filling) and the emergency eyewash and shower remained unobstructed.

29 CFR 1910.178(l)(4)(i): Refresher training, including an evaluation of the effectiveness of that training, shall be conducted as required by paragraph (l)(4)(ii) to ensure that the operator has the knowledge and skills needed to operate the powered industrial truck safely: On or about January 8, 2024 employees engaged in cold storage activities at United States Cold Storage located at 4302 South 30th Street, Omaha, Nebraska were exposed to crushing and struck-by hazards in that the employer did not conduct refresher training and/or an evaluation of the effectiveness of training to ensure the operator had the knowledge and skills needed to operate the powered industrial truck safely. Instances included but were not limited to: i. Operator(s) involved in an accident or near-miss incident and, ii. Evaluation of each powered industrial truck operators' performance at least once every three years.

29 CFR 1926.451(c)(2)(v) Applicable to general industry employment as defined by 29 CFR 1910.27(a): Fork-lifts shall not be used to support scaffold platforms unless the entire platform is attached to the fork and the fork-lift is not moved horizontally while the platform is occupied: On or about January 16, 2024, employees engaged in pallet recovery activities at United States Cold Storage located at 4302 South 30th Street, Omaha, Nebraska were exposed to fall hazards in that the employer did not ensure the reach stacker safety cage attachment D-rings properly clasped to secure the basket chain to the vehicle mast.
